Abstract

A new 2,6-di(anthracen-9-yl)pyridine ligand L reacts with various silver(I) salts to give three new complexes: mononuclear [AgL(NO3)] and [AgL(i-PrOH)2](BF4), and dinuclear [AgL(μ-H2O)AgL](BF4)2·3CH2Cl2. The complexes have been characterized by spectroscopic techniques and elemental analysis. The solid state structures of the complexes have been determined by X-ray diffractometry. Methylene blue (MB) degradation was studied by UV–Vis spectrophotometry. The new complexes of silver(I) are active photocatalysts of MB degradation under sunlight irradiation.
